All of lore.kernel.org
 help / color / mirror / Atom feed
* Possible problem with stk1160 driver
@ 2013-07-16 22:04 Sergey 'Jin' Bostandzhyan
  2013-07-16 22:45 ` Ezequiel Garcia
  2013-07-17  8:44 ` Ezequiel Garcia
  0 siblings, 2 replies; 9+ messages in thread
From: Sergey 'Jin' Bostandzhyan @ 2013-07-16 22:04 UTC (permalink / raw)
  To: linux-media

Hi,

I am not quite sure if the problem is in the driver or if the user space
applications are doing something in a weird or wrong way, I hope you can
help me.

I have one of those easycap 4x-input devices with a Syntek chip:
Bus 001 Device 002: ID 05e1:0408 Syntek Semiconductor Co., Ltd STK1160 Video Capture Device

I'm on 3.9.9-201.fc18.i686.PAE kernel, using the stk1160 driver.

It generally works fine, I can, for example, open the video device using VLC,
select one of the inputs and get the picture.

However, programs like motion or zoneminder fail, I am not quite sure if it
is something that they might be doing or if it is a problem in the driver.

Basically, for both of the above, the problem is that VIDIOC_S_INPUT fails
with EBUSY.

I do not see any errors in the message log, only:
Jul 16 21:27:24 localhost kernel: [ 9477.574448] stk1160: queue_setup: buffer
+count 8, each 829440 bytes
Jul 16 21:27:24 localhost kernel: [ 9477.595667] stk1160: setting alternate 5

I somewhat assume that it works with VLC because when switching the input you
more or less "open a new device", while zoneminder/motion might try to
change the input while actually streaming.

I'd appreciate any help or hint, also in case if you think that it's not the
driver issue, maybe you have an idea what I should be looking for (i.e.
what other operations might cause the VIDIOC_S_INPUT ioctl to fail?).

Kind regards,
Sergey


^ permalink raw reply	[flat|nested] 9+ messages in thread

end of thread, other threads:[~2013-07-18 22:19 UTC | newest]

Thread overview: 9+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2013-07-16 22:04 Possible problem with stk1160 driver Sergey 'Jin' Bostandzhyan
2013-07-16 22:45 ` Ezequiel Garcia
2013-07-17  8:44 ` Ezequiel Garcia
2013-07-17 21:31   ` Sergey 'Jin' Bostandzhyan
2013-07-18  0:17     ` Ezequiel Garcia
2013-07-18  0:44       ` Sergey 'Jin' Bostandzhyan
2013-07-18  6:31       ` Hans Verkuil
2013-07-18 12:55         ` Ezequiel Garcia
2013-07-18 22:19           ` Sergey 'Jin' Bostandzhyan

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.